技术文摘
阿里研究员:缩减软件开发反馈弧
2024-12-31 07:50:01 小编
阿里研究员:缩减软件开发反馈弧
在当今竞争激烈的科技领域,软件开发的效率和质量成为了企业取得成功的关键因素。阿里研究员们聚焦于一个重要的议题——缩减软件开发反馈弧,为行业带来了新的思考和解决方案。
软件开发反馈弧,简单来说,就是从开发者编写代码到获得关于这段代码效果的反馈之间的时间间隔。过长的反馈弧会导致一系列问题,如开发周期延长、错误难以及时发现和修复、开发成本增加等。
阿里研究员们深知,要缩减这一反馈弧,首先需要优化开发流程。通过引入敏捷开发方法,将大项目分解为多个小的迭代周期,每个周期都能快速得到用户和测试团队的反馈,及时调整开发方向。
自动化测试工具的应用也是关键。在代码提交后,自动进行一系列的单元测试、集成测试和系统测试,迅速给出测试结果,让开发者能够第一时间了解代码的质量和可能存在的问题。
代码审查环节的改进也有助于缩短反馈弧。采用更加高效的在线协作工具,让审查人员能够实时提出意见和建议,开发者能够及时修改,避免了传统线下审查的时间延迟。
加强与用户的沟通和互动也是必不可少的。通过收集用户的实时反馈,了解他们在使用软件过程中的痛点和需求,将这些信息快速传递给开发团队,从而让开发工作更具针对性。
在阿里的实践中,缩减软件开发反馈弧带来了显著的成效。开发周期大幅缩短,产品能够更快地推向市场,抢占先机。同时,软件质量也得到了提升,用户满意度增加,为企业带来了良好的口碑和经济效益。
阿里研究员们对于缩减软件开发反馈弧的研究和实践,为整个软件开发行业树立了榜样。其他企业和开发者也应借鉴这些经验,不断优化自身的开发流程,提高开发效率和质量,以适应快速变化的市场需求和激烈的竞争环境。
- 用 HTML、CSS 与 jQuery 打造带动画效果的加载进度条
- HTML 布局技巧:运用定位布局实现精准定位控制
- CSS 弹性布局属性全解:position sticky 与 flexbox
- HTML、CSS与jQuery实现图片懒加载之滚动触发技巧
- Layui开发支持随机生成验证码登录系统的方法
- uniapp中实现页面跳转与路由导航的方法
- 用HTML与CSS打造响应式图片网格布局的方法
- CSS进度条的progress和value属性
- uniapp中快递员管理与配送管理的实现方法
- Layui框架下开发支持即时订单管理餐饮外卖平台的方法
- Layui 实现可拖拽时间选择器功能的方法
- HTML、CSS 和 jQuery 打造响应式标签云的方法
- 利用Layui实现图片放大缩小幻灯片效果的方法
- JavaScript 实现页面滚动动画效果的方法
- CSS面板布局属性:grid与grid-template-columns指南